TalentCraft allows you to create content for your course and organize it in tabs, making it easier for users to have an overview of certain information.
Here’s how to build content in tabs:
1. Log in to the TalentLMS as an Administrator or Instructor and either create a new course or edit an existing one. Then, click to Add or Edit a TalentCraft unit. For new units, select the Start from scratch (1) option.
2. Hover over the toolbar at the bottom and click Tabs (2). Sample tabs will be added with sample text and images.
3. Click Tabs to the left and use the selection tool to pick your preferred layout for tab content: Tabs or Accordion (3).
4. Select any tab to make it active, and then click the title of each one to add your own text. Each tab can contain text and an image of your choice. Highlight your text and use the toolbar to edit its properties.
To add more tabs, click the + icon (4) or use the Trash bin (5) to remove one.
Under the image, you’ll find a set of image action buttons (6) that let you manage the image in several ways. You can click Select image to replace the current image with one from available sources, such as the Library and others described here.
If you want to make changes to the existing image, click Edit image to open the editing options, where you can crop the image, apply filters, or use AI-powered tools to add different effects. You can also add more information to the image, such as a title and description.
If you no longer want to use an image, click the Trash bin icon to delete it. After deleting it, a popup message will appear, giving you 5 seconds to click Undo and restore the image. Once that message disappears, the deletion becomes permanent.
| Note: Maximum image file size limit is 10MB. |
Click Update or Publish unit to save the changes for your TalentCraft unit.
